Junction City Police I.D. Shooting Victims

The Junction City Police Dept. has identified the victims of a weekend shooting that killed one man and injured another woman.

Reports identify the man as Fort Riley soldier Joshua Wilcoxen, 22, of A. Co. 101st FSB and the woman as 19 year-old Emma Wilcoxen.

On Saturday, Junction City officers responded to calls of a shooting at 401 1/2 N. Jackson Cir. There, they found Mr. Wilcoxen with a gunshot wound to the head and Mrs. Wilcoxen shot in her left hand.

Emergency crews transported Mr. Wilcoxen to Geary Community Hospital where he later died. Mrs. Wilcoxen also was taken to Geary for treatment, before being transported to Manhattan.

According to the Junction City police, Mr. Wilcoxen died of a self inflicted gunshot wound to the head. Mrs. Wilcoxen's injury came as she tried tried to stop Mr. Wilcoxen from shooting himself.
